Can You Buy Milkshake with EBT/ Food Stamps?

Yes, you can buy milkshake with EBT or Food Stamps.

This is because milkshakes are considered a cold beverage, which falls under the category of eligible food items. As long as the milkshake is purchased from a grocery store or other retailer that accepts SNAP benefits, it qualifies for purchase. However, if the milkshake is bought from a restaurant or fast-food establishment, it would not be eligible under SNAP guidelines.

How to Check If Milkshake Is SNAP-Eligible

To determine if an item is SNAP-eligible, check its label. If it has a “Nutrition Facts” label, it is likely eligible. Conversely, items with a “Supplement Facts” label are not eligible. Additionally, if the item is hot, prepared, and meant for immediate consumption, it is likely not SNAP-eligible. For example:

  • Frozen pizza: It’s cold, packaged, and intended for home consumption. Therefore, it is SNAP-eligible.

  • Hot soup from a deli: It’s hot, prepared, and meant for immediate consumption. Therefore, it is not SNAP-eligible.

If in doubt, compare the product to USDA rules to determine SNAP eligibility.

Additionally, large chain stores often use small shelf labels or icons that say "SNAP Eligible" or "EBT Accepted." Websites of large chains like Walmart, Amazon, or delivery platforms like Instacart often let you filter by SNAP-eligible items. If still unsure, ask the shop assistant before making a purchase.

Surprising Things You Can Buy with EBT

Besides milkshake, you might be surprised to know that SNAP benefits cover many of these items:

  • Plants: Vegetable seeds, fruit plants, and starters used to grow food at home.

  • Farmers’ Markets: Eligible at many markets, often via tokens or electronic payments.

  • Energy Drinks: Eligible if labeled with a "Nutrition Facts" panel (not "Supplement Facts").

  • Bakery Items and Birthday Cakes: Decorated birthday cakes and baked goods.

  • Seafood and Fresh Meat: Fresh, frozen, or canned seafood and meats.

  • Snack Foods: Chips, ice cream, candy, and other snacks.

What Happens If You Try to Buy an Ineligible Item with an EBT Card?

If you try to buy an ineligible item with your EBT card, the transaction will be declined at checkout. The cashier or the self-checkout system will notify you that the item cannot be purchased with SNAP benefits. You will need to use another form of payment or remove the item from your purchase. This ensures that SNAP benefits are used only for approved items.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are there any restrictions on the type of milkshake you can buy with EBT?

Yes, there are restrictions. The milkshake must be a cold beverage purchased from a grocery store or retailer that accepts SNAP benefits. Milkshakes bought from restaurants or fast-food establishments are not eligible.

Can you buy a milkshake mix with EBT?

Yes, you can buy a milkshake mix with EBT. Since it is a packaged item intended for home preparation and consumption, it qualifies as a SNAP-eligible food item.

Does the eligibility of milkshake purchases vary by state?

No, the eligibility of milkshake purchases does not vary by state. SNAP is a federal program, and its guidelines are consistent across all states. Milkshakes are eligible as long as they meet the federal criteria.

Can you buy a milkshake as part of a larger grocery purchase with EBT?

Yes, you can buy a milkshake as part of a larger grocery purchase with EBT. As long as the milkshake and other items in your basket are SNAP-eligible, the entire purchase can be made using your EBT card.
